Output 66e75f61aed4080f97989aeba906278df44b17efcb9ed74830a97fa316ceb8fe:1

value
67112
script pubkey
OP_0 OP_PUSHBYTES_20 3d437cf7ac0849cf01274345f3661245ba9dbc49
address
bc1q84pheaavppyu7qf8gdzlxesjgkafm0zfzvuw4e
transaction
66e75f61aed4080f97989aeba906278df44b17efcb9ed74830a97fa316ceb8fe
spent
true